Kampala is the largest city of Uganda and it became the capital city after acquiring independence in 1962. Uganda’s Capital is situated in the Buganda region, which is the largest traditional kingdom in Uganda. Kampala has a handful of tourism sites that offer fascinating information on the history of Uganda. Places such as Kasubi Royal Tombs, Uganda Museum, Uganda national Museum, and many other sites.

After your morning breakfast, go and experience the unique trek in Mountain Rwenzori. This Trek starts at 8:30 from Kyanjiki 12 kilometers from Kasese town where you will meet your tour guides for a briefing. You will then walk up the Nsuranja Valley towards Kalalama Camp to a rock shelter known as Musenge Rock Shelterat 2,240 meters a distance of 6,2 kilometers from the Rangers post. The walk is a steady climb through Pristine Forest with a multitude of birds as well as Chimpanzees scampering off if you are in luck. However, you will definitely see Chimpanzee nests high up in the trees made of branches interwoven to form a nest. The Chimpanzees use these nests for several weeks then move on when the season for fruiting trees is over. The main attraction in these forests is the wide variety of plant species and you can catch the blue monkey once in a while but it is not guaranteed. Your hike will end at around 3pm and you will return to your lodge for late lunch or packed lunch, dinner and overnight stay at Margherita hotel.

After Lunch, Drive to Kyambura Gorge for a forest walk to look for the habituated Chimpanzees and many other primates. This Gorge is about 16km long in the rift valley and 100 meters deep, you will be briefed by experienced rangers and walking sticks will be provided by us. After this enlightening experience, you will return to your Baboon safari resort lodge for dinner and overnight stay.

Early Morning after your breakfast, transfer to the park headquarters for the briefing with your packed lunch before you enter the Gorilla sanctuary of Bwindi Forest. The rainforest is spectacular as it offers a dramatic, heavily forested and dense landscape crisscrossed by numerous animal trails, allowing access for tourists. This park is best known for the fascinating mountain Gorillas, where the time taken and terrain varies according to the movements of the majestic primates. The thrill of spending time observing these animals’ daily activities is an exciting and rare adventure. The Gorillas are peaceful creatures that can easily be aggravated but you will be briefed by your tour guide on how to behave around these enormous animals. After this amazing experience, return to Bahoma community rest camp for dinner and overnight.
